近年来,随着互联网的迅猛发展,DDoS(分布式拒绝服务)攻击已经成为网络安全领域的一大威胁。它不仅会给企业带来经济损失,还会对品牌形象造成严重损害。如何有效防范DDoS攻击成为云服务器运营者必须面对的重要问题。
一、选择可靠的云服务商
选择具有较强抗DDoS攻击能力的云服务商是防范DDoS攻击的第一步。优质的云服务商通常会提供全面的安全防护措施,如高防IP、流量清洗等。他们还具备专业的安全团队,能够及时响应并处理突发的安全事件。在选择云服务商时,还要关注其服务质量协议(SLA),确保在遭受攻击时可以获得相应的赔偿或支持。
二、部署流量清洗与黑洞路由
流量清洗是一种常见的DDoS攻击防御手段,通过识别和过滤异常流量,从而保护目标服务器免受恶意攻击。当检测到大规模DDoS攻击时,云服务商可以将攻击流量引导至专门的清洗中心进行处理,只允许合法请求到达目标服务器。而黑洞路由则是在攻击流量超出一定阈值后,直接将所有流量丢弃,以防止服务器被彻底淹没。这两种方法虽然不能完全阻止攻击,但可以在一定程度上减轻攻击带来的影响。
三、设置访问控制策略
合理的访问控制策略有助于减少潜在的安全风险。例如,限制特定IP地址或地区的访问权限,或者要求用户进行身份验证才能使用某些功能。对于一些重要的业务接口,还可以采用速率限制的方式,防止恶意程序短时间内发起大量请求。定期检查和更新访问规则也非常重要,以适应不断变化的网络环境。
四、启用Web应用防火墙(WAF)
Web应用防火墙(WAF)可以为网站提供额外的安全防护层。它能够实时监测HTTP/HTTPS流量,识别并阻止SQL注入、XSS跨站脚本攻击等各种Web应用层攻击。对于DDoS攻击而言,WAF同样发挥着重要作用。它可以准确区分正常请求和恶意请求,并根据预定义规则进行拦截或放行操作。许多现代WAF产品还支持自动化学习和自适应调整,进一步提高了防护效果。
五、构建弹性架构
为了应对突如其来的流量高峰,云服务器需要具备良好的弹性和可扩展性。一方面,可以通过增加服务器实例数量来分散压力;则要优化应用程序代码,提高其并发处理能力和资源利用率。采用负载均衡技术也是实现弹性架构的关键环节之一。它可以根据实际需求动态分配任务给不同的节点,确保整个系统稳定运行。
六、加强监控与预警机制
建立完善的监控体系对于及时发现和处置DDoS攻击至关重要。这包括但不限于网络流量、CPU占用率、内存使用情况等方面的指标监测。一旦发现异常波动,系统应立即发出警报通知相关人员介入调查。结合历史数据分析,还可以预测未来可能出现的风险点,提前做好预防措施。
七、定期演练与应急响应计划
尽管已经采取了多种防御措施,但仍无法百分之百地避免DDoS攻击的发生。制定详细的应急响应计划就显得尤为必要。该计划应当涵盖从发现问题、启动应急预案直至恢复正常服务的全过程,并明确各部门职责分工。除此之外,定期组织模拟演练也有助于提高团队协作能力和实战经验。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/41875.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。